diff options
Diffstat (limited to 'release/scripts/startup/nodes/types.py')
-rw-r--r-- | release/scripts/startup/nodes/types.py |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/release/scripts/startup/nodes/types.py b/release/scripts/startup/nodes/types.py new file mode 100644 index 00000000000..82cc2562793 --- /dev/null +++ b/release/scripts/startup/nodes/types.py @@ -0,0 +1,16 @@ +from . import sockets as s +from . types_base import DataTypesInfo + +type_infos = DataTypesInfo() + +type_infos.insert_data_type(s.FloatSocket, s.FloatListSocket) +type_infos.insert_data_type(s.VectorSocket, s.VectorListSocket) +type_infos.insert_data_type(s.IntegerSocket, s.IntegerListSocket) +type_infos.insert_data_type(s.BooleanSocket, s.BooleanListSocket) +type_infos.insert_data_type(s.ObjectSocket, s.ObjectListSocket) +type_infos.insert_data_type(s.ImageSocket, s.ImageListSocket) +type_infos.insert_data_type(s.ColorSocket, s.ColorListSocket) +type_infos.insert_data_type(s.TextSocket, s.TextListSocket) +type_infos.insert_data_type(s.SurfaceHookSocket, s.SurfaceHookListSocket) + +type_infos.insert_conversion_group(["Boolean", "Integer", "Float"]) |